I'm trying to install WhatsApp application on a domain joined Windows 10 PC. I must enter administrator password to install the application but the source file was installed into Administrator profile.
Every time the non-admin user tries to open WhatsApp, the computer asks for Administrator password. I can't give the administrator password to the user.
I want WhatsApp to be installed in C:\Program Files. But the installer doesn't give an option to choose the installation path.
This problem also applies to Viber Desktop and Slack. How can I solve this?
